Delhi FSL Job Openings for 2026



Delhi FSL Recruitment 2026: The Forensic Science Laboratory (FSL) under the Delhi Government's Home Department has announced job openings for the year 2026. A total of 45 vacancies are available for the roles of Junior Scientific Officer and Junior Scientific Assistant on a contractual basis. Interested candidates are invited to submit their applications either in person or via registered/speed post to the Head of the FSL office in Rohini by 5:00 PM on January 15, 2026.


Eligibility Criteria

Who is eligible to apply?


For the Junior Scientific Assistant (Biology) role, applicants must possess a postgraduate degree in Zoology, Botany, Microbiology, or Forensic Science. Candidates with a BE or B. Tech in Biotechnology are also eligible. Importantly, no prior experience is necessary, making this position suitable for fresh graduates.


For the Junior Scientific Officer role, candidates need a postgraduate degree in a relevant field such as Chemistry, Physics, or Biology, along with a minimum of 3 years of research or investigative experience in the respective area, which is mandatory for this position.


Selection Process

How will candidates be selected?


The selection process for the Delhi FSL Recruitment 2026 will adhere to a structured approach. Initially, applications will be reviewed to verify educational qualifications and required documents. Candidates who meet the eligibility criteria will be shortlisted based on their qualifications and experience.


Shortlisted individuals will be invited for a personal interview at the FSL office in Rohini, where original documents will be verified. The final selection will depend on the candidate's medical fitness.


Interview Schedule

When will the interviews take place?


The walk-in interviews for the Delhi FSL Recruitment 2026 will occur at the FSL office in Rohini, Delhi. Candidates are required to arrive by 9:30 AM on their designated interview date. Interviews for the Chemistry, Biology, and Cyber Forensics departments for Junior Scientific Assistants (JSA) and the Chemistry and Biology departments for Junior Scientific Officers (JSO) will be conducted on January 28, 2026. Interviews for the Ballistics and Physics departments for both JSA and JSO will take place on January 29, 2026.


Salary Information

What are the salary details?


Selected Junior Scientific Assistants (JSA) will receive a fixed monthly salary of ₹42,632. Junior Scientific Officers (JSO) will be compensated according to existing contractual regulations, which were previously around ₹68,697 per month.
